Service Description: Provides family and child support as well as advocacy to the community members * acts as a liaison between families of Nipissing First Nation and the Children’s Aid Societies * provide case management, access services, community resources, and referrals to families in the system * helps in the recruitment of new foster parents
Fees: Free
Application: Intake assessment required
Eligibility - Population(s) Served: Members of Nipissing First Nation on and off-reserve with children under 18 years of age
